1. Minimalist Serenity
Reduce clutter and embrace clean lines to create a peaceful environment. Soft, neutral tones like whites and beiges dominate the space, making it feel open and calm. Floating vanities and minimal fixtures enhance the sense of tranquility.
2. Stone and Water Balance
Incorporate natural elements such as smooth stones for countertops and gentle water features to create harmony between earth and water. A freestanding tub or stone sinks add an organic touch.
3. Calm Neutrals Oasis
Use a soft color palette of beige, gray, and ivory to create a relaxing atmosphere. These neutral tones diffuse light, keeping the bathroom bright and airy while promoting a clutter-free aesthetic.
4. Wood and Water Harmony
Blend the warmth of wood with the fluidity of water. Wooden vanities or flooring combined with sleek faucets and stone basins enhance the Zen ambiance.
5. Soft Lighting Tranquility
Opt for warm, diffused lighting to eliminate harsh shadows. Recessed lighting, candles, and dimmable options contribute to a soothing, spa-like feel.

13. Japanese Soaking Tub Simplicity
Install a deep soaking tub (ofuro) for an immersive bathing experience. These tubs, often made from wood or stone, align with Zen principles of mindfulness and relaxation.
